Course Content

• Introduction to Cybersecurity Fundamentals: Threats, vulnerabilities, and risks.
• Network Security Basics: Firewalls, intrusion detection, and VPNs.
• Cybersecurity Hygiene: Password management, phishing awareness, and safe browsing practices.
• Data Privacy and Protection: Regulations (like COPPA), data breaches, and ethical considerations.
• Cryptography Basics: Encryption, decryption, and digital signatures.
• Ethical Hacking and Penetration Testing (Introduction): Safe and legal methods of identifying vulnerabilities.
• Incident Response: Understanding and responding to security incidents.
• Cloud Security: Securing data and applications in the cloud.

Instead of a formal certificate, youth-focused programs often provide foundational knowledge in digital citizenship, online safety, and basic security concepts.


Learning outcomes for age-appropriate cybersecurity programs for kids typically include understanding online privacy, identifying phishing attempts, creating strong passwords, and recognizing different types of cyber threats. They might also cover responsible social media use and safe internet browsing habits. These programs are crucial for developing digital literacy and promoting safe online behavior.


The duration of such programs varies widely, ranging from short workshops (a few hours) to longer courses spanning several weeks or months. Some schools integrate cybersecurity concepts into existing curricula, while others offer dedicated summer camps or after-school programs. The intensity and length depend entirely on the program's design and the age group targeted.
